Kongsberg also did .22lr conversions on the M1914. What was really unique upon these conversion sets was the fact that they used an excentric .22lr barrel with a .45 ACP chamber and a .45 magazine, holding 7 dummy bullets of solid steel where each is holding a .22lr round in it.
Note that every single dummy bullet is proof marked and the fact the barrel which has NO serial number at all.
PS: I haven't fired it yet, but I guess you have to manually push back the slide after each shot is being fired. But note that there are no locking lugs on the barrel, so there's a slight chance it might function this way ..Information
